Xbox LIVE Games Coming to iOS

Microsoft has posted an online job listing according to which the Redmond software giant needs an experienced developer who will bring the greatest gaming experience to numerous mobile platforms, including Apple’s iOS.

Microsoft has shown quite some interest in developing software for third-party platforms recently, and this recent move to hire a Software Development Engineer for bringing games to mobes indicates that Xbox LIVE games are now headed to iPhone, iPad, and iPod touch.

According to the job advertisement, “[The] Xbox LIVE Mobile team is looking for a passionate and experienced developer to join us in bringing Xbox LIVE entertainment experiences to various platforms.”

“As the team inside IEB (Interactive entertainment Business) dedicated to mobile experiences, we work closely with the console software team and Xbox LIVE services to bring the latest and greatest gaming and entertainment experience to mobile platforms including Windows Phone, iOS, and other mobile platforms.”
